Using Plant Growth-promoting Fungi (PGPF), as a Biofertilizer and Biocontrol Agents against Tetranychus cucurbitacearum on Nubian Watermelon (Citrullus lanatus L.)

Abstract: Plant growth-promoting fungi (PGPF) have attracted considerable interest as biofertilizers and biocontrol due to their multiple beneficial effects on plant quantity and quality as well as their positive relationship with the ecological environment. The objective of this study was to determine the efficacy of different concentrations 25, 50, 75 and 100% from cultural filtrate of Trichoderma viride and T. harzianum to induce the two-spotted spider mite, Tetranychus cucurbitacearum (In vitro), and their ability t… Show more
